Paul Kateley is a motivated and creative lighting cameraman with experience in a variety of settings, including live shows, studio peds, and location lighting.

He has operated various equipment from jimmy jibs to DSLRs, showcasing his versatility and technical skills.

With a background in high-profile projects like interviews with the Duke of Cambridge and coverage of anti-semitism in the Labour Party, Paul has a proven track record in the industry.

His work spans across different genres, from sports events like the English Football League matches to entertainment shows like Jessie J's ROSE tour.

Paul has contributed to major events like the Sochi 2014 Winter Olympics and Festival of Life, displaying his adaptability and professionalism.

His expertise also extends to commercial projects like 'Mamma Mia Commercial' and 'Sky Vegas Live,' where he demonstrated his lighting director skills with studio game shows.

Paul's experience includes working on global broadcasts like the Olympic Games in Rio 2016 and Winter Youth Olympic Games in Innsbruck 2012, highlighting his international exposure.

He has collaborated with renowned directors and production companies, such as Radical Media and Chilli Media, further solidifying his reputation in the industry.

Education-wise, Paul studied Design & Media Management, Video Production & Advertising, and Design & Media Management at reputable institutions, enhancing his theoretical knowledge and practical skills.

Throughout his career, Paul has held various roles at prominent organizations, including Freelance, Studio Lambert USA, Inc., and OBS Madrid - Olympic Host Broadcaster, showcasing his adaptability and extensive experience in the field.
